Abstract

<P>P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a fascia board decorative plate capable of ventilating an attic, preventing fire and hot air from intruding into the attic by cutting off a ventilation passage in a fire, and attractively treating an eaves. <P>SOLUTION: This fascia board decorative plate comprises a front surface covering part 11 which covers the front surface 41 of a fascia board 4 and a bottom surface covering part 13 which covers the bottom surface 42 of the fascia board 4 and forms a hollow ventilation chamber 3 on the lower side thereof. The inside of the ventilation chamber 3 is longitudinally divided into two parts by a shielding plate 2 extending downward from the rear side of the front surface covering part 11. The ventilation passage is formed under the shielding plate 2. A plurality of vent holes 31 are formed in the front wall surface 131 of the ventilation chamber 3 opposed to the front surface of the shielding plate 2. A heat-foaming material 20 is installed on the rear side of the shielding plate 2. <P>COPYRIGHT: (C)2009,JPO&INPIT

本発明は、屋根裏を換気できるとともに、火災時には通気経路を遮断して火炎や熱風などが屋根裏に侵入するのを防止できる鼻隠し化粧板に関する。   The present invention relates to a nose cover plate capable of ventilating an attic and blocking a ventilation path in a fire to prevent intrusion of flames, hot air, and the like into the attic.

通常、鼻隠しは軒先に張り出した垂木の端部を隠すために取り付けられるが、この鼻隠しによって屋根裏への空気の流通が遮断されることがある。
そこで、軒天井に通気孔を設けたり、通気孔が設けられた鼻隠し化粧板で鼻隠しの底面を覆ったりすることが行われているが、火災が発生したときに火炎や熱風が通気孔から屋根裏に侵入して二次火災を起こすことがあった(例えば、特許文献1参照)。
Normally, a nose cover is attached to hide the edge of the rafters protruding from the eaves, but this nose cover may block air flow to the attic.
Therefore, it is practiced to provide ventilation holes on the eaves ceiling or to cover the bottom of the nose cover with a nose cover decorative board provided with ventilation holes. May enter the attic and cause a secondary fire (see, for example, Patent Document 1).

火災時に火炎や熱風が屋根裏に侵入するのを防止するため、例えば図4に示すように、鼻隠し91の後面側と軒天井92との間に上・下部材からなる換気部材93を取り付け、上部材に形成した換気口93aと下部材に形成した通気孔93bとが連通する通気経路に加熱発泡材94を設置し、火災時に通気孔93bから侵入した火炎や熱風で加熱発泡材94を膨張させて通気経路を遮断するようにした構成のものが知られている(特許文献2参照)。   In order to prevent flames and hot air from entering the attic in the event of a fire, for example, as shown in FIG. 4, a ventilation member 93 composed of upper and lower members is attached between the rear side of the nose cover 91 and the eaves ceiling 92, A heating foam material 94 is installed in a ventilation path where a ventilation port 93a formed in the upper member communicates with a ventilation hole 93b formed in the lower member, and the heating foam material 94 is expanded by a flame or hot air that has entered from the ventilation hole 93b in the event of a fire. The thing of the structure which was made to interrupt | block an aeration path | route is known (refer patent document 2).

しかしながら、この図4に示した構成のものは、通気経路の下面に加熱発泡材94が設置されているため、通気孔93bから侵入した雨水によって加熱発泡材94が水浸しとなったり、劣化して火災時に発泡しないという問題が発生することがある。また、この換気部材93を軒先に取り付けたとき、鼻隠し91は換気部材93の前面側から露出して見えるため、軒先を下から見上げたとき頗る見栄えが悪いという問題がある。   However, in the configuration shown in FIG. 4, since the heating foam material 94 is installed on the lower surface of the ventilation path, the heating foam material 94 may be submerged or deteriorated by rainwater entering from the ventilation holes 93b. The problem of not foaming during a fire may occur. Further, when the ventilation member 93 is attached to the eaves tip, the nose cover 91 appears to be exposed from the front side of the ventilation member 93, so that there is a problem that it looks bad when the eaves tip is looked up from below.

この問題を解決するため、本出願人は、換気室の軒天側の裏壁面に通気孔を穿設するとともに、換気室の底壁面から遮蔽板を立ち上げ、通気孔と対向する遮蔽板の上部に加熱発泡材を装着したものを提案した。しかしながら、この構成では雨水を伴った空気が通気孔から換気室内に浸入したとき、直接加熱発泡材に雨水があたることによって水浸しになることがあり、火災時に加熱発泡材が機能しないという新たな問題が提起されるに至った(特許文献3参照)。
特開平7−259282号公報 特開平9−203134号公報 特開2007−204970号公報
In order to solve this problem, the present applicant drilled a vent on the back wall on the eaves side of the ventilation chamber, raised a shielding plate from the bottom wall of the ventilation chamber, and installed a shielding plate facing the ventilation hole. We proposed the one with heating foam on top. However, in this configuration, when air with rainwater enters the ventilation chamber from the vent hole, the heated foam material may be submerged by direct contact with the rainwater, and the heated foam material does not function in the event of a fire. (See Patent Document 3).
JP 7-259282 A JP-A-9-203134 JP 2007-204970 A

本発明は従来技術の有するこのような問題点に鑑み、屋根裏への換気が十分に行えるようにするとともに、雨水が通気孔から通気経路に浸入し難い構造とし、たとえ通気通路に雨水が浸入しても加熱発泡材が水浸しになったり、劣化する虞がなく、火災時には膨張した加熱発泡材で通気経路が完全に遮断され、しかも軒先を下から見上げたときに見栄えのよい構成とすることを課題とする。   In view of such problems of the prior art, the present invention makes it possible to sufficiently ventilate the attic and makes it difficult for rainwater to enter the ventilation path from the ventilation hole, even if rainwater enters the ventilation path. However, there is no risk that the heated foam material will become soaked or deteriorated, and in the event of a fire, the ventilation path will be completely blocked by the expanded heated foam material, and the structure will look good when looking up from the eaves. Let it be an issue.

前記課題を解決するため本発明は、鼻隠しの前面を覆う前面被覆部と、鼻隠しの底面を覆うとともにその下方に中空状の換気室を形成する底面被覆部を有する鼻隠し化粧板であって、前面被覆部の裏側から垂下した遮蔽板で換気室内を前後に二分し、遮蔽板の下方に通気経路を形成し、かつ遮蔽板の前面と対向する換気室の前壁面に複数の通気孔を穿設するとともに、遮蔽板の裏面側に加熱発泡材を装着したことを特徴とする。   In order to solve the above problems, the present invention is a nose cover decorative plate having a front cover portion covering the front surface of the nose cover and a bottom cover portion covering the bottom surface of the nose cover and forming a hollow ventilation chamber below the front cover portion. The ventilation chamber is divided into two parts in the front and rear by a shielding plate hanging from the back side of the front covering portion, a ventilation path is formed below the shielding plate, and a plurality of ventilation holes are formed on the front wall of the ventilation chamber facing the front surface of the shielding plate. And a heating foam material is mounted on the back side of the shielding plate.

本発明の鼻隠し化粧板は、鼻隠しの前面を覆う前面被覆部と、鼻隠しの底面を覆うとともにその下方に中空状の換気室を形成する底面被覆部からなり、換気室は前面被覆部の裏側から垂下する遮蔽板で前後に二分し、遮蔽板の下方に空気の通気経路が形成される。そして、換気室の前壁面には、空気の流入口となる複数の通気孔が穿設されているため、該通気孔から流入した空気は遮蔽板で遮られてから遮蔽板の下方を潜り抜け、遮蔽板の裏側に回り込んで上昇してから屋根裏に流入することにより換気が行われる。   The nasal cover of the present invention comprises a front covering part that covers the front of the nasal concealment, and a bottom covering part that covers the bottom of the nasal concealment and forms a hollow ventilation chamber below the front covering part. An air ventilation path is formed below the shielding plate by dividing the front and rear by a shielding plate that hangs down from the back side. Since the front wall surface of the ventilation chamber is provided with a plurality of air holes serving as air inlets, the air flowing in from the air holes is blocked by the shielding plate and then passes under the shielding plate. Ventilation is performed by going up to the back side of the shielding plate and rising and then flowing into the attic.

このような構成とすることで、雨水が換気室へ浸入し難くなり、加熱発泡材は換気室を二分する遮蔽板の裏側に装着されているため、雨水を伴った空気が換気室に流入しても当該加熱発泡材が水浸しになることはない。また、火災時に火炎や熱風が通気経路に侵入したときには、加熱発泡材が膨張して遮蔽板の裏側の通気経路が完全に遮断されることにより、屋根裏への火炎や熱風の侵入が防止される。なお、加熱発泡材は遮蔽板の裏面に直接装着することができるが、遮蔽板と対向する換気室の裏面側に装着しても同様の効果が期待できる。   This configuration makes it difficult for rainwater to enter the ventilation chamber, and the heating foam is attached to the back of the shielding plate that bisects the ventilation chamber, so air with rainwater flows into the ventilation chamber. However, the heated foam material is not soaked in water. In addition, when a flame or hot air enters the ventilation path in the event of a fire, the heated foam material expands and the ventilation path on the back side of the shielding plate is completely blocked, thereby preventing the entry of flame or hot air into the attic. . In addition, although a heating foam material can be directly mounted | worn on the back surface of a shielding board, the same effect can be anticipated even if it mounts | wears with the back surface side of the ventilation chamber facing a shielding board.

本発明の鼻隠し化粧板は、空気の流入口となる通気孔が換気室の前壁面に設けられているため、軒先を下から見上げても通気孔が目に触れることはなく、鼻隠しの前面及び底面が鼻隠し化粧板で一体的に覆われることと相俟って、軒先下面をすっきりとした状態で、見栄えよく処理することができる。   In the nose masking decorative board of the present invention, since the air hole serving as the air inlet is provided on the front wall surface of the ventilation chamber, the air hole does not touch the eyes even when looking up from the bottom of the eaves. Combined with the fact that the front and bottom surfaces are integrally covered with the nose cover, the front surface and the bottom surface of the eaves can be processed cleanly.

また、換気室を二分する遮蔽板の上端部に鼻隠しの底面が係止される係止片を設けることができる。   Moreover, the latching piece by which the bottom face of a nose cover is latched can be provided in the upper end part of the shielding board which bisects a ventilation chamber.

このような構成とすることで、鼻隠し化粧板を鼻隠しに取り付けるとき、係止片を鼻隠しの底面に押し当てるだけで鼻隠し化粧板の高さ調整や位置合わせが簡単に行え、足場の不安定な高所での鼻隠し化粧板の位置決め作業やビスや釘などの支持金具の打ち込み作業が簡単かつ確実に行うことができる。   With this configuration, when attaching the nasal cover to the nasal cover, the height and positioning of the nasal cover can be easily adjusted simply by pressing the locking piece against the bottom of the nasal cover. It is possible to easily and reliably perform the positioning operation of the nose cover plate and the driving operation of the support fitting such as a screw or a nail at an unstable high place.

本発明の鼻隠し化粧板は、屋根裏への通気を良好にして十分な換気が行えるとともに、火災時には膨張した加熱発泡材が通気経路を遮断するため、火炎や熱風が屋根裏に侵入するのを防止できる。また、本発明の鼻隠し化粧板は鼻隠しの前面及び底面を一体的に覆うため、軒先下面がすっきりとしたイメージとなり、軒先を見栄えよく処理することができる。   The nose cover decorative board of the present invention provides good ventilation to the attic and provides sufficient ventilation, and in the event of a fire, the expanded foam foam blocks the ventilation path, preventing flames and hot air from entering the attic. it can. In addition, since the nose cover decorative plate of the present invention integrally covers the front and bottom surfaces of the nose cover, the lower surface of the eaves becomes a clean image, and the eaves can be processed with good appearance.

本発明の鼻隠し化粧板1は、例えば表面を塩化ビニル樹脂で覆うなどの耐蝕加工が施された被覆鋼板や、亜鉛鋼板などの耐火性を有する長尺の鋼板をベンダーなどで折り曲げて形成したものであって、鼻隠し4の前面41を覆う前面被覆部11の下方に軒先前方に突出する庇状の突出部12が形成され、該突出部12の下方に鼻隠し4の底面42を覆うとともに中空状の換気室3を形成する底面被覆部13が形成されている。また、前面被覆部11の上端は、当該前面被覆部11に対して直角に軒先前方へ折れ曲がってから更に斜め下方へ屈曲しており、その前端支持部14が後述する水切り6の折返部61に係合するようになっている。   The nose cover decorative board 1 according to the present invention is formed by bending a coated steel sheet with a corrosion resistance process such as covering the surface with a vinyl chloride resin or a long steel sheet having fire resistance such as a zinc steel sheet with a bender or the like. A hook-like protrusion 12 that protrudes forward of the eaves tip is formed below the front cover 11 that covers the front face 41 of the nose cover 4, and the bottom face 42 of the nose cover 4 is covered below the protrusion 12. In addition, a bottom surface covering portion 13 that forms a hollow ventilation chamber 3 is formed. Further, the upper end of the front covering portion 11 is bent at a right angle with respect to the front covering portion 11 to the front of the eaves and further bent obliquely downward. It is designed to engage.

図1に示すように、鼻隠し4の前面41はほぼ垂直で、その底面42は垂木5の底面51とほぼ同角度で傾斜しており、鼻隠し4の底面42は垂木5の底面51より上方に位置して設けられている。本発明の鼻隠し化粧板1は、前面被覆部11が鼻隠し4の前面41を覆ってビスや釘などの支持金具Pで打ち込み固定されるものであって、前面被覆部11の下方に折り曲げ形成された底面被覆部13が鼻隠し4の底面42を覆うとともに中空状の換気室3を形成し、底面被覆部13の裏壁面133の上端から家屋側へ斜め上方に延出した後端支持部15が垂木5の底面51にビスや釘などの支持金具Pで打ち込み固定される。   As shown in FIG. 1, the front surface 41 of the nose cover 4 is substantially vertical, and the bottom surface 42 is inclined at substantially the same angle as the bottom surface 51 of the rafter 5. It is located above. The nose cover decorative plate 1 of the present invention is such that the front cover portion 11 covers the front face 41 of the nose cover 4 and is fixed by being driven by a support fitting P such as a screw or a nail, and is bent below the front cover portion 11. The formed bottom covering portion 13 covers the bottom face 42 of the nose cover 4 and forms a hollow ventilation chamber 3. The rear end support extends obliquely upward from the upper end of the back wall surface 133 of the bottom covering portion 13 to the house side. The portion 15 is driven and fixed to the bottom surface 51 of the rafter 5 with a support fitting P such as a screw or a nail.

このようにして鼻隠し化粧板1の後端支持部15が垂木5の底面51に固定されると、後端支持部15と鼻隠し4の底面42との間に軒裏通路32が形成され、該軒裏通路32が屋根裏に連通して換気が行われる。   In this way, when the rear end support 15 of the nose cover decorative plate 1 is fixed to the bottom surface 51 of the rafter 5, the eaves passage 32 is formed between the rear end support 15 and the bottom 42 of the nose cover 4. The eaves passage 32 communicates with the attic for ventilation.

換気室3は、前面被覆部11の下方を折り曲げて前側面131、底壁面132及び裏壁面133によって囲まれた中空状となっていればよく、換気室3は、矩形状、略U字状、台形状、湾曲状等に形成できる。
遮蔽板2は、前面被覆部11の裏面側から形成され、換気孔31から屋根裏が見えないように、換気室3を前後にニ分する配置すればよく、遮蔽板2の下方が通気経路となって前後が連通している。
遮蔽板2の配置は、換気室3の形状が矩形状あるいは略U字状であれば、遮蔽板2を前面被覆部11の裏面より垂下させて配置すればよく、また、換気室3の前壁面131が換気室側に傾斜した台形状であれば、前面被覆部11の裏面より前壁面131と略並行になるように配置すればよい。
The ventilation chamber 3 only needs to have a hollow shape surrounded by the front side surface 131, the bottom wall surface 132, and the back wall surface 133 by bending the lower side of the front covering portion 11, and the ventilation chamber 3 is rectangular and substantially U-shaped. It can be formed into a trapezoidal shape, a curved shape, or the like.
The shielding plate 2 is formed from the back surface side of the front covering portion 11 and may be arranged so as to divide the ventilation chamber 3 forward and backward so that the attic can not be seen from the ventilation hole 31. The front and back are in communication.
If the shape of the ventilation chamber 3 is rectangular or substantially U-shaped, the shielding plate 2 may be arranged so that the shielding plate 2 is suspended from the back surface of the front covering portion 11. If the wall surface 131 has a trapezoidal shape inclined toward the ventilation chamber, the wall surface 131 may be disposed so as to be substantially parallel to the front wall surface 131 from the back surface of the front cover portion 11.

遮蔽板2の前面と対向する換気室3の前壁面131には、空気の流入口となる複数の通気孔31が穿設されている。図2aに示すように、通気孔31は上下2段に亘って設けられており、上下方向に長い縦長の通気孔31が前壁面31の長手方向(水平方向)に沿って所定の間隔で多数列設されている。また、図2bに示すように通気孔31は1段であってもよいし、多段に設けてもよい。   A plurality of vent holes 31 serving as air inlets are formed in the front wall surface 131 of the ventilation chamber 3 facing the front surface of the shielding plate 2. As shown in FIG. 2a, the vent holes 31 are provided in two upper and lower stages, and a number of vertically long vent holes 31 that are long in the vertical direction are arranged at predetermined intervals along the longitudinal direction (horizontal direction) of the front wall surface 31. It is lined up. Further, as shown in FIG. 2b, the vent hole 31 may be provided in a single stage or in multiple stages.

換気室3を前後に二分する遮蔽板2の下端は裏面側に折り返されて断面U字状の支持部22が形成されており、該支持部22に長尺帯状の加熱発泡材20が装着されている。加熱発泡材20としては、グラファイト系熱膨張材(インツメックス社製)、ブチル系やエポキシ系の熱膨張材が好適に使用できるが、これ以外にも火災時に火炎や熱風を受けたとき体積膨張して遮蔽板2の裏側の通気通路を遮断する機能を有するものならいかなるものでも使用できる。   The lower end of the shielding plate 2 that bisects the ventilation chamber 3 is folded back to the back side to form a support portion 22 having a U-shaped cross section, and a long strip-shaped heating foam material 20 is attached to the support portion 22. ing. As the heating foam material 20, a graphite-based thermal expansion material (manufactured by Intsumex), a butyl-based or epoxy-based thermal expansion material can be preferably used. Any material can be used as long as it has a function of blocking the ventilation passage on the back side of the shielding plate 2.

遮蔽板2の上部は前面被覆部11の裏側にリベットなどで固定されており、その上端部には鼻隠し4の底面42に沿う形状に折れ曲がった係止片21が設けられている。この係止片21は鼻隠し化粧板1を鼻隠し4に固定する際に位置決めとなるものであって、鼻隠し化粧板1の前面被覆部11を鼻隠し4の前面41に押し付けながら係止片21を鼻隠し4の底面42に係止させるだけで鼻隠し化粧板1を所定の取付位置にセットすることができる。   The upper portion of the shielding plate 2 is fixed to the back side of the front covering portion 11 with a rivet or the like, and a locking piece 21 bent in a shape along the bottom surface 42 of the nose cover 4 is provided at the upper end portion thereof. The locking piece 21 is positioned when the nose cover decorative plate 1 is fixed to the nose cover 4 and is locked while pressing the front cover 11 of the nose cover decorative plate 1 against the front surface 41 of the nose cover 4. By simply locking the piece 21 to the bottom surface 42 of the nose cover 4, the nose cover decorative plate 1 can be set at a predetermined mounting position.

次に、この鼻隠し化粧板1を軒先に取り付ける際の作業手順を説明する。図1に示すように、まず鼻隠し化粧板1の前面被覆部11を鼻隠し4の前面41に固定する。このとき、前面被覆部11の裏面を鼻隠し4の前面41にあてがい、前端支持部14を屋根の野路板に固定されている水切り6の折返部61に係合させながら、前面被覆部11の裏側に設けられている係止片21を鼻隠し4の底面42に押し当てつつ、ビスや釘などの支持金具Pを前面被覆部11から鼻隠し4に打ち込む。このようにすると、鼻隠し化粧板1の高さ調整や位置合わせが簡単に行え、足場の不安定な高所でも鼻隠し化粧板1の取り付け作業が簡単かつ確実に行える。次いで、鼻隠し化粧板1の後端支持部15にビスや釘などの支持金具Pを打ち込んで垂木5の底面51に固定することにより、鼻隠し4の底面42と後端支持部15との間に屋根裏に通じる軒裏通路32が形成される。   Next, an operation procedure for attaching the nose masking decorative board 1 to the eaves will be described. As shown in FIG. 1, first, the front covering portion 11 of the nose cover decorative plate 1 is fixed to the front surface 41 of the nose cover 4. At this time, the back surface of the front surface covering portion 11 is applied to the front surface 41 of the nose cover 4, and the front end support portion 14 is engaged with the folded portion 61 of the drainer 6 fixed to the roof path plate. While pressing the locking piece 21 provided on the back side against the bottom surface 42 of the nose cover 4, a support fitting P such as a screw or a nail is driven into the nose cover 4 from the front cover portion 11. If it does in this way, height adjustment and position alignment of the nasal concealment decorative board 1 can be performed easily, and the attachment operation | work of the nasal concealment decorative board 1 can be performed easily and reliably also in the high place where the scaffold is unstable. Next, a support fitting P such as a screw or a nail is driven into the rear end support portion 15 of the nose cover decorative plate 1 and fixed to the bottom surface 51 of the rafter 5, so that the bottom surface 42 of the nose cover 4 and the rear end support portion 15 are fixed. An eaves passage 32 leading to the attic is formed therebetween.

そこで、図3に示すように、鼻隠し化粧板1の前面被覆部11に軒先に沿って所定間隔に軒樋吊具7を取り付け、該軒樋吊具7の耳把持部に軒樋8の耳部を係止させて支持する。このとき、軒樋吊具7の上方に突出した支持部材71に通水孔を有する軒樋カバー81を固定して軒樋8の開口部を覆うことにより、落ち葉などが軒樋8内に侵入するのを防止することができる。図中の符号9は軒天井であって、鼻隠し化粧板1の裏壁面133に形成した段部134に軒天井9の端部を載せて取り付けることにより、軒樋8の取付と軒先回りの施工作業が完了する。   Therefore, as shown in FIG. 3, eaves hooks 7 are attached to the front surface covering portion 11 of the nose cover decorative plate 1 along the eaves at predetermined intervals, and the eaves hooks 8 are attached to the ear grips of the eaves hooks 7. The ear is locked and supported. At this time, by fixing the eave ridge cover 81 having a water passage hole to the support member 71 protruding above the eave ridge suspension 7 and covering the opening of the eave ridge 8, fallen leaves and the like enter the eave ridge 8. Can be prevented. Reference numeral 9 in the figure denotes an eaves ceiling, and by mounting the end of the eaves ceiling 9 on the stepped part 134 formed on the back wall surface 133 of the nose cover decorative plate 1, Construction work is completed.

かくして、鼻隠し化粧板1で鼻隠し4の前面41及び底面42が一体的に覆われ、鼻隠し化粧板1の軒先側に軒樋8が設置される。すなわち、鼻隠し化粧板1の前面被覆部11で鼻隠し4の前面41が覆われ、底面被覆部13で鼻隠し4の底面42が覆われるとともに、空気の通気経路を構成する換気室3が形成され、換気室3の前壁面131と軒樋8の後側壁との間に下向きに開口した通気経路が形成される。そして、換気室3は前面被覆部11の裏側から垂下する遮蔽板2で前後に二分し、かつ遮蔽板2の下方に空気の通気経路が形成されるため、換気室3の前壁面131に穿設された通気孔31から流入した空気は遮蔽板2の下方を潜り抜け、遮蔽板2の裏側に回り込んでから上昇することにより屋根裏の換気が行われる。   Thus, the front face 41 and the bottom face 42 of the nose cover 4 are integrally covered with the nose cover decorative board 1, and the eaves 8 is installed on the eaves side of the nose cover decorative board 1. That is, the front surface 41 of the nose cover 4 is covered with the front surface covering portion 11 of the nose cover decorative plate 1, the bottom surface 42 of the nose cover 4 is covered with the bottom surface covering portion 13, and the ventilation chamber 3 constituting the air ventilation path is formed. A vent path that is formed to open downward is formed between the front wall 131 of the ventilation chamber 3 and the rear side wall of the eaves 8. The ventilation chamber 3 is divided into a front and a rear by a shielding plate 2 that hangs down from the back side of the front covering portion 11, and an air ventilation path is formed below the shielding plate 2, so that the front wall 131 of the ventilation chamber 3 is perforated. The air that has flowed in from the provided vent hole 31 passes under the shielding plate 2, wraps around the back side of the shielding plate 2, and then rises to ventilate the attic.

通常、屋根裏の換気は以上のようにして行われるか、換気室3の前壁面131と軒樋8の後側壁との間は下向きに開口した通気経路となっているため、雨水は換気室へ浸入し難くなり、しかも加熱発泡材20は換気室3を二分する遮蔽板2の裏側に装着されているため、雨水を伴った空気が換気室3に流入しても当該加熱発泡材20が水浸しになることはない。また、火災時に火炎や熱風が通気経路に侵入したときには、加熱発泡材20が膨張して遮蔽板2の裏側の通気経路を遮断するため、火炎や熱風などが屋根裏へ侵入するのを完全に防止することができる。   Normally, the attic is ventilated as described above, or since there is a downwardly ventilating path between the front wall 131 of the ventilation chamber 3 and the rear side wall of the eaves 8, rainwater enters the ventilation chamber. Since the heating foam material 20 is attached to the back side of the shielding plate 2 that bisects the ventilation chamber 3, the heating foam material 20 is submerged even if air with rainwater flows into the ventilation chamber 3. Never become. In addition, when a flame or hot air enters the ventilation path in the event of a fire, the heated foam material 20 expands and blocks the ventilation path on the back side of the shielding plate 2, thereby completely preventing flames and hot air from entering the attic. can do.

なお、図示した鼻隠し化粧板1は本発明の実施形態の一例を示すものであり、家屋の軒先の構成や、軒樋の形状などに応じて適宜な形状とすることができる。また、加熱発泡材20は換気室3を形成する裏壁面133に装着することもできる。   In addition, the illustrated nose cover decorative board 1 shows an example of an embodiment of the present invention, and can have an appropriate shape according to the configuration of the eaves of the house, the shape of the eaves, and the like. Further, the heating foam material 20 can be attached to the back wall surface 133 that forms the ventilation chamber 3.
